Webpayment with token and cryptogram. IoT transactions are very similar to Apple Pay, Visa Checkout and other in-app transactions. The merchant does not need to integrate with Visa they ust need to be able to accept tokenized payments. WebMay 7, 2024 · The secure element on the device generates a dynamic cryptogram for each transaction using the token, token key, amount, and other information related to the transaction. This dynamic cryptogram is then sent to the payment processor along with the token (DAN), transaction amount, and other required information to process the transaction. WebA cryptogram is a word puzzle featuring encrypted text that the user decrypts to reveal a message of some sort. Once used for message security, cryptograms are now typically only used for entertainment purposes in newspapers and magazines.
